Delaware Machinery AR-15 in .223 Wylde: Precision, Power, and Adaptability
This meticulously crafted Delaware Machinery AR-15, chambered in the versatile .223 Wylde, is a standout model that blends the rugged utility of a tactical rifle with the precision of a target shooter's dream. The rifle is in excellent condition with only faint signs of prior use, primarily minor blemishes on the upper and lower receivers. Its bore condition is pristine, boasting a clean, mirror finish with sharp rifling, indicative of minimal wear and meticulous maintenance.
The AR-15 features an 18-inch threaded barrel equipped with a muzzle brake/flash hider and a 1:7 twist rate, optimizing stability and accuracy. A 12" free float handguard ensures improved barrel harmonics and accuracy, while the ambidextrous charging handle enhances usability for both left and right-handed shooters. The black finish not only adds a sleek, professional look but also provides durability and corrosion resistance.
From a historical perspective, the AR-15 was originally designed by Eugene Stoner in the 1950s and has evolved into one of the most popular rifle platforms in the U.S. While Delaware Machinery is not a primary historical manufacturer, their rendition of this iconic model maintains the high standards expected from AR-15 rifles. It utilizes a direct impingement system, known for its reliability and ease of maintenance.
The synthetic adjustable M4 style stock, coupled with a Blackhawk soft touch rubber pistol grip, offers comfortable handling and adaptability to various body types and shooting styles. The picatinny rails provide ample space for optics and other accessories, making it highly customizable.
